What real mid-level management looks like

It is rarely the glamorous boardroom version. It is hiring well, holding under-performers honestly, reading a P&L without panicking, making operational trade-offs under pressure, and being the calmest person in the room when a customer or supplier blows up. The Advanced Diploma in Business and Management Studies focuses on those competencies, with enough strategy and analysis to make you credible at the next step up.
